A Double shoe brake is capable of absorbing a torque of 1400 N-m. The diameter of the brake drum is 350 mm and the angle of contact for each shoe is 100o. if the coefficient of friction between the lining and brake drum is 0.4. Evaluate (i) the springs force necessary to set the brake (ii) the width of the brake shoes, if the bearing pressure on the lining material is not to exceed 0.3 N/mm2.
